java,I/O那符号“\\”和“/”都表示路径吧?
在Java中斜杠和反斜杠都有各自不同的意思,其中:斜杠“/”表示地址路径的下一级目录;反斜杠“\”表示转义字符,例如:要做制表,可以输入:\t;做换行:\n等。
\是Window平台上用于路径分隔的符号,在程序中使用\\是为了转义\符号来表示正真的\。/是liunx平台下的路径分隔符号,不需要转义。但是一般在程序中也可以/,因为它可以默认的来识别。
“/”:表示根目录。“//”:绝对路径。“.”:文件名分割符。“..”:上一级目录。“#”文件路径号。\:文件显示分割符。“?”文件通配符。
从windows系统上传文件至linux服务器,Java代码中要怎么处理路径?
1、ftpClient.setControlEncoding(GBK);// 设置文件类型(二进制)ftpClient.setFileType(FTPClient.BINARY_FILE_TYPE);ftpClient.storeFile(fileName, fis);Log.info(上传文件成功:+fileName+。
2、filename);FileUtils.copyFile(uploadfile, saveFile);FileUtils是apache common io的类一般你没就就去下一个jar,上面的与系统无关,移植性很强。
3、linux查看当前所在目录的全路径?打开shell连接工具,连接上服务器,pwd查看当前目录,一般进来默认在主目录下。通过命令:cd/切换到主目录下,然后pwd查看当前目录,并用ls可以查看当前目录下的文件及目录。
win10中javac命令中-classpath中如果又两个路径,中间怎么分隔,分隔符是...
用英文的分号(;)做分隔符。一个问题,没必要一下子提好几遍。懂的网友看见了,肯定会回答您的。只是时间问题而已。
.表示当前目录,就是编译或者执行程序时你所在的目录。分号; 是分隔符,分隔多个路径。classpath的作用就是在你执行 javac XXX.java 进行编译时,告诉javac程序到哪里去找XXX.java这个文件。
在我的电脑界面,鼠标右键点击“此电脑”。在弹出的列表中,点击最下方的“属性”。在跳转到的界面中,点击“高级系统设置”。在弹出的系统属性界面,点击右下方的“环境变量”。
javac命令,编译源文件.java,产生二进制.class文件。这个命令是有javac编译器实现的,执行时会去查找类。我们都会在环境变量中设置classpath,这个类路径就是javac命令查找文件的顺序。
java的分隔符有哪些
在Java中,: 具有多种不同的含义。点击学习大厂名师精品课作为分隔符:冒号通常用作分隔符来分隔不同的代码元素或值。例如,在Java的条件语句中,可以使用冒号分隔条件和执行的代码块。
Java中,具有代码分割作用的符号就是分隔符。圆点“.”、分号“;”、花括号“{}”和空格具有特殊的分隔作用,我们将其统称为分隔符。
“-”是Java 8新增的Lambda表达式中,变量和临时代码块的分隔符,即:(变量)-{代码块} 如果代码块只有一个表达式,大括号可以省略。如果变量类型可以自动推断出来,可以不写变量类型。
Java中split主要用于分隔字符串。具体分析如下:如果用“.”作为分隔的话,必须是如下写法,String.split(\\.),这样才能正确的分隔开,不能用String.split(.)。
stringObj.split([separator,[limit]])参数stringObj 必选项。要被分解的 String 对象或文字。该对象不会被 split 方法修改。separator 可选项。字符串或 正则表达式 对象,它标识了分隔字符串时使用的是一个还是多个字符。
得加个参数:public StringTokenizer(String theString,String delimiters)因为delimiters是复数,所以可以有多个分隔符,比如:String delimiters=“\n.,”这三种分隔符不用什么符号隔开。这是我在absolute java里看到的。
java路径string中的“\\”怎么替换成“//”
1、i、replace方法 该方法的作用是替换字符串中所有指定的字符,然后生成一个新的字符串。经过该方法调用以后,原来的字符串不发生改变。
2、String msgIn;String msgOut;msgOut=msgIn.replaceAll(\\\,\\\);原因:\在java中是一个转义字符,所以需要用两个代表一个。例如System.out.println( \\ ) ;只打印出一个\。
3、使用replaceAll对字符串进行查找替换可以满足你的要求。
4、java中转义某个特殊字符 需要在特殊字符前面加上反斜杠 。因为\是转义字符 为特殊字符 所以 \\代表\。所有的ASCII码都可以用\加数字(一般是8进制数字)来表示。
java中怎么写文件路径
1、File类有两个常用方法可以得到文件路径一个是:getCanonicalPath(),另一个是:getAbsolutePath(),可以通过File类的实例调用这两个方法例如file.getAbsolutePath()其中file是File的实例对象。
2、XMLS.class.getClass().getResourceAsStream(/test/test.txt);解释:XMLS.class.getClass()是获取当前的类编译路径,之后通过getResourceAsStream的形式即可找到要读取的文件的路径。
3、有绝对路径与相对路径两种: 绝对路径 :以引用文件之网页所在位置为参考基础,而建立出的目录路径。 绝对路径:以Web站点根目录为参考基础的目录路径。
4、如果spring的配置文件在src路径下,在web.xml中要加载配置文件,路径应该是这样:classpath:spring(文件名字).xml 如果在其他路径下,就要写绝对路径了。
5、除非你把properties文件放到MyClass.class所属的包里面,不然都会是null的。 使用java.lang.ClassLoader类的getResourceAsStream(String name)方法 路径是不能加斜杠的!非常重要。
java路径的分隔符代码的介绍就聊到这里吧,感谢你花时间阅读本站内容,更多关于java的路径怎么配、java路径的分隔符代码的信息别忘了在本站进行查找喔。